Station Facilities and Amenities

Machynlleth Train Station is equipped to cater to a range of needs, ensuring a smooth journey for all passengers. The station is accessible to everyone, with step-free access prominently available. Whether you're heading to Shrewsbury or further afield, you can collect tickets bought online from the ticket office, which opens early to serve morning commuters from 05:15 AM and stays open until 18:15 PM on weekdays. While there are no ticket machines, the staff will be happy to assist with any inquiries you might have—either at the help point or directly at the ticket office.

For those waiting for their train, the station offers waiting rooms and accessible toilets, although patrons should note there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site. Cyclists are welcome, with bike storage equipped with CCTV to ensure your bicycle’s safety. Car enthusiasts will be pleased to find a 24-hour car park, managed by Transport for Wales, which boasts 30 spaces including 2 accessible bays. And guess what—it's free!

Facilities and Amenities

Stalybridge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ly reduced hours on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, ticket machines are readily available for collection, and smartcards can also be issued here, though validators are not. With step-free access throughout, heated waiting rooms on platforms 1, 3, and 4, and accessible toilets, the station ensures a comfortable experience for all passengers.

The station's commitment to accessibility is evident not only in the architectural design but also in its customer support services. Station staff are on hand to assist from early morning until late evening, ensuring help is always available when needed. Additionally, for those requiring special assistance, boarding ramps and other facilities are readily accessible.

Bicycle and Car Parking

For cyclists, Stalybridge Station has embraced environmentally-friendly travel by providing 32 bicycle storage spaces, including s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as. Car parking is offered with 12 spaces available, three of which are designated as accessible, free of charge, and open 24 hours every day. Onward Travel Options

No journey starts or ends at Stalybridge Station without convenient onward travel options. The station is connected to a variety of local transport networks. For those in need of a taxi, you'll find the nearest taxi rank on Rassbottom Street. If buses are your preferred mode, Bus Stop E on Market Street serves as the rail replacement service pick-up point, making it easy to switch travel modes efficiently.
